Job Description

To provide support to introducers and Policyholders to deliver superior levels of service across all General Insurance products. To understand the needs of, and to develop positive relationships with General Insurance clients and their financial advisers, both existing and new. To work closely with internal departments to ensure all business and enquiries are processed in a compliant and coordinated fashion.

Role Responsibilities:
– Process applications for new business
– Issue policy documents and endorsements and renewal documentation
– Provide a superior level of customer support when dealing with client and intermediary queries
– Deal with queries in an efficient and in a timely manner
– Be able to review and advise clients of full details of outstanding requirements
– Maintain true and accurate handling of correspondence in a timely manner
– Administer all incoming work and enquiries as received
– Maintain scanned records in accordance with departmental processes and procedures
– Accurate processing of receipt of payments
– Production and issuing of commission payments
– Preparation and checking of premium bordereaux
– Maintain positive relationships with clients and general insurance schemes underwritten
– Assist the department with the review of policies and procedures
– Review and process claims in line with procedures
– Assist and provide support to other departments or companies within the Group
– Updating and maintaining appropriate systems (including CRM).
